- Supervise and develop the team: Train, schedule, and supervise maintenance team members, providing guidance and support to ensure high-quality work and performance
- Ensure facility safety and compliance: Support maintenance of the physical building, mechanical systems, electrical systems, HVAC, and life safety systems, ensuring compliance with local and national regulations
- Supervise maintenance operations: Assign and oversee daily maintenance tasks, ensuring through documentation of work in the property management system
- Oversee contractor work: Supervise external contractors and inspect completed work for quality and compliance
- Respond to service requests: Ensure that maintenance requests, guest concerns, and emergency situations are addressed promptly and efficiently
- Maintain fixtures and fittings: Conduct scheduled and ad hoc maintenance, including planned preventive maintenance (PPM) and service requests, to ensure hotel fixtures and fittings remain in safe condition
